Grasping Registered Agents
A statutory agent holds a vital role in maintaining the legal compliance of a company. They serve as the primary point of contact for receiving critical legal notices, such as summons, tax notifications, and compliance reminders. This duty ensures that businesses can quickly respond to any legal issues and stay informed about their obligations, resulting to smooth operations and governance.
Businesses are mandated to have a registered agent in the jurisdiction where they are formed or operate. This requirement differs by state, with particular registered agent rules that must be followed. Comprehending these regulations is essential for entrepreneurs, as it assists them select a trustworthy registered agent service that meets their requirements. Regardless of whether for an Limited Liability Company or a corporate entity, having registered agent services in position is critical for operational and legal integrity.
Registered agents can be an independent agent or a registered agent company that focuses in this field. Many businesses prefer professional registered agents, especially those that operate in multiple states, as they offer nationwide registered agent services and help streamline compliance management. By hiring a statutory agent, business owners can concentrate on their core operations while making sure their legal requirements are consistently fulfilled.

Criteria for Appointing a Registered Agent and Associated Costs
When starting a new venture, understanding the criteria for selecting a registered agent is essential. Most states mandate that every LLC designates a registered agent, who must have a physical address in the state where the business is established. This ensures a reliable point of contact for legal proceedings and legal notifications. Businesses may consider hiring a registered agent company or appoint an individual, but they must adhere to state regulations regarding the agent's accessibility and documentation responsibilities.
The price of registered agent services can experience considerable variation based on several factors, including the company and the degree of service available. Typically, businesses can expect pay between $50 and $300 annually for registered agent services. Some companies offer additional features, such as compliance alerts and mail management, which can raise the total price. It's crucial to consider the value of these additional services when selecting a registered agent, as they might conserve your business time and reduce legal risks.
When assessing registered agent costs, be mindful of any re-registration costs and the risk of unexpected fees. Some companies may advertise low initial rates but enforce higher fees for ongoing services or additional features. Doing thorough research and reading reviews can aid in discovering budget-friendly yet dependable registered agent services that fit your business's requirements. Always ensure that the agent you designate meets all regulatory standards to maintain your entity's good standing.

Lawful Responsibilities of Designated Agents
Designated agents hold essential lawful duties that guarantee a business complies with state laws. One of their primary functions is to act as an agent for legal notifications, which means they accept legal documents and official communications on behalf of the business. This includes alerts for lawsuits, financial papers, and regulatory filings, making sure that the business is aware about legal matters in a prompt manner. With effective management of these communications, designated agents help reduce risks and safeguard the company from overlooking crucial due dates.
Additionally, designated representatives are tasked with keeping correct and up-to-date records for their clients. This includes making sure that the business’s designated address is up-to-date and in line with local requirements. They are also tasked with forwarding important documents to the business promptly, which helps in ensuring compliance with annual reporting and additional corporate governance obligations. By managing these duties, registered agents play a vital role in supporting corporate compliance and facilitating smooth operations.
Additionally, registered agents must adhere to statutory laws specific to the state in which the company operates. This means understanding the variations in registered agent regulations across different jurisdictions. Neglect to fulfill these responsibilities can result in serious consequences, including monetary penalties, penalties, and the potential dissolution of the company. As such, choosing a reliable registered representative is essential for ensuring that a business remains in compliance and addresses its legal obligations properly.
